THE inauguration felt anticlimactic to Midnight. A vow, a number code to access the Orgánosi's bases and a tattoo at the back, below his nape—that was it—and he was immediately sent to Italy for 'first continental training'. Out of concern, Dominick accompanied Midnight to the Orgánosi's private airport.

"We will continue to hide your digital footprint." Dominick informed Midnight before Midnight entered the plane bound for Italy. "But I'm certain your father can find you since you're going to Europe. We will try our best to protect you on our end, but Silvanus thinks that your safety would be more guaranteed if your father doesn't know about the treatment we did. You'll be safer that way."

Silvanus was concerned that if Kelleon found out, he might do something to Midnight again. That would be catastrophic because Midnight's brain couldn't bear another chaos.

Midnight had always been sharp and immediately understood what Dominick meant. "You want me to act like my old self." It was a statement, not a question.

Dominick nodded. "That way, we wouldn't raise your father's suspicion, and he won't do something to you. Just pretend to be obedient for now."

"Pretending? I'm good at that," Midnight said in a nonchalant voice. "I'll take care of myself."

Dominick smiled and raised his hand to pat Midnight's head. "Be careful. Call if you need anything. If you can't contact me, call Klaus. And if you want someone to talk to, Silvanus said he's free anytime. And don't forget the person I recommended if you have free time." Then quickly added when he remembered something. "Also, chat with my princess from time to time, will you? I'm sure she's bored being stuck on the farm every day."

Midnight agreed and then waved his hand as he entered the plane.

After he settled in his seat, he watched Dominick leave from the plane's window.

He actually knew the reason why Dominick asked him to pretend like his old self. It's because Dominick couldn't protect him and fight his father for him. And he would never ask Dominick to do that. That old man already did a lot for him and helping him meant Happy would be dragged into the mess as well. He didn't want that since he knew all Dominick wanted for Happy was peace and good health.

And this was his own battle. Knowing how vile his father was, he would never want to drag anyone into his mess.

When Midnight couldn't see Dominick anymore, he closed his eyes and whispered thank you in his heart. What the old man had done for him was something he would never forget, and he would forever be grateful.

And if he could repay the old man by protecting Happy when needed—that wouldn't be enough for everything Dominick did for him—he would do it in a heartbeat.

Midnight felt the plane move and rose to the sky. He opened his eyes again and looked down to see the city below.

I'll be back. Hopefully, he would be a better and competent continental boss by then.

MIDNIGHT arrived in Rome near dawn. The Orgánosi's people who picked him up in the airport brought him to the Racini's Hotel. In his allotted room, there was a laptop on the corner table with an 'open me' sticky note pasted to it.

With no exhaustion on his face after that over eight hours' flight, he dropped his duffel bag and sat on the chair and opened the laptop.

The laptop only had two documents saved and one video file.

The first document was his schedule for the entire year. He had to memorize it because it'll self-destruct the moment he closed the laptop.

The second document was the kind of training he'll received for the whole year here.
